Actress and theatre artist Juhi Babbar, also known for being veteran actor Raj Babbar’s daughter took to her social media account to remember late superstar Dharmendra with a sweet anecdote of her life, featuring him.
Sharing a few pictures of herself from her childhood days along with Dharmendra, Juhi wrote, “Dharam Uncle my memories of you go back to when I was a very little girl, when my mom, Gorky(aaryababbar222 )and I were accompanying Papa for a shoot in Kullu Manali.” She added, “I remember you noticing how scared I was of the river flowing next to the hotel, and you lifted me onto your back and carried me to the water. That moment stayed with me so deeply that years later, when I was creating my play With Love, Aapki Saiyaara I actually recreated that memory through a photoshopped visual of the two of us!”
